At age 77, conjunto artist Santiago Jimenez Jr. will release a new 10-song album Friday night at the Lonesome Rose.

Scott Ball / San Antonio ReportThe 86th record could introduce Jimenez to a whole new audience., having recorded with Johnny Cash, Willie Nelson, Doug Sahm, Waylon Jennings, Ray Price, Glen Campbell, and Jimenez’s older brother Flaco Jimenez, among many others.

“I liked the idea of being able to put a regional legend in a world music platform,” Dayton said, speaking of the potential to reach audiences throughout North and South America, Europe, and beyond.The Hardcharger label is an imprint of Los Angeles-based Blue Élan Records, which also puts out Dayton’s music. But the Austinite still had to convince his LA colleagues that a Jimenez record was the right move.

Younger listeners are getting turned on to older music through its timeless appeal, Dayton said, citing the example of producer Rick Rubin making iconic recordings ofMy job is to get the record to everyone,” he said, “and let them know that, ‘Hey, if you’re into Los Lobos, and The Clash … buy this record, put it on while you’re having a barbecue in your backyard, you will have San Antonio exported into your backyard.
